The Rise of Machine Learning

Machine learning, a subset of artificial intelligence, is the process of training algorithms to learn patterns in data. From virtual assistants to self-driving cars, machine learning is making its way into nearly every industry. Traditional programming methods involve a series of rules that are created based on specific inputs and desired outputs. However, machine learning algorithms can adapt to new data in real-time, making them incredibly powerful for solving complex problems.

Applications of Machine Learning

Machine learning has already been implemented in a wide variety of applications, including:
  • Fraud detection
  • Customer segmentation
  • Speech recognition
  • Medical diagnosis
As more companies adopt machine learning technology, it is likely that we will see new use cases emerge.
